Course Description
The Jockey Club de Rosario is a sports club in Rosario, Argentina, offering various sports and activities such as football, rugby, hockey, polo, and more. It also has a country club, a library, and a variety of other facilities.

How difficult is Jockey Rosario for mid-handicap golfers?
Jockey Rosario presents a demanding test. With a slope of 120, it remains playable for a wide handicap range. The course rating of 70 reflects on scoring relative to par 72.
What tees should a 15 handicap play at Jockey Rosario?
A 15 handicap golfer should consider tees closer to 6000 yards. The back tees extend to 6500 yards, which makes approach shots longer and scoring more challenging.
What is considered a good score at Jockey Rosario?
With a course rating of 70 and par 72, a mid-handicap golfer would typically score in the mid to high 80s. Stronger players aiming to break 72 must manage approach shots and avoid penalty strokes.
